Name That Chord: Major Or Minor

In this exercise you are to listen to the audio example and determine if it is a major or minor chord. You may not know how to play chords yet, but that's alright. We're just listening for the major or minor 3rd interval that are in the chords. If you could tell the differnce between the major and minor 3rd then this should be pretty easy for you. Press the the play button to hear a chord then check the box that describes the chord you heard. Press the submit button to see if you're right.

Remember the major chord will sound rather common, whereas the minor will have what some people will call a "sad" sound. Good luck!
